About the Jacksonville Jaguars
The Jacksonville Jaguars are a professional football team and a member of the National Football League’s AFC South Division. The Jaguars are one of the NFL’s youngest franchises, playing their first regular season home game on Sept. 3, 1995, in Jacksonville, Fla., and have since won four division titles. The Jaguars are owned by Shahid Khan, a visionary leader whose businesses include Flex-N-Gate, Fulham Football Club, All Elite Wrestling, Bold Events and Iguana Investments. Since 2012, Mr. Khan’s impact on the Northeast Florida community has exceeded $500 million, including charitable giving through the Jaguars Foundation, capital improvements to EverBank Stadium and the creation of Daily’s Place, which hosts upwards of 40 concerts a year. The Jaguars and Iguana Investments opened the Miller Electric Center, a state-of-the-art sports performance center in 2023, which now houses all of football operations for the Jaguars, including players, coaches and other personnel. Over the next several years, the Jaguars and Iguana Investments will complete Phase 1 of the Jacksonville Shipyards, a reimagination of the riverfront which will include a Four Seasons Hotel and Private Residences, an office building inclusive of the Jaguars front office headquarters, and a modernized marina and support building, as well as begin additional projects to transform the area around the stadium into a year-round, mixed-use sports and entertainment district.
In 2024, the Jaguars and the City of Jacksonville announced plans to move forward with a reimagined Stadium of the Future, securing Jaguars football in Jacksonville for generations to come, plus a continuation of annual traditions of the Florida-Georgia Football Classic and TaxSlayer Gator Bowl while also opening opportunities for future Super Bowls, Final Four tournaments, college football playoffs, marquee concerts and more. Using research derived from Jaguars fans, stadium guests and a comprehensive assessment of the facility's structure, the Stadium of the Future will be a world-class venue for a world-class city that showcases a facility that is environmentally friendly, cost effective and presents state-of-the-art innovation. The Stadium of the Future features a protective canopy, wider concourses, new communal spaces, scenic lookout decks, immersive in-bowl technology, new seating types and a public Floridian nature park.

Summary
The Legends Manager is a critical component to the Jaguars dedication and efforts to support its players throughout the entirety of their career and beyond. This role is actively involved in the off-the-field development of players and their transition away from the game. It is primarily tasked with establishing long-lasting, meaningful relationships predicated on trust, creating and executing holistic professional growth and the wellbeing of former players.
Job Responsibilities
- Coordinate events and programs including Legends Weekend, Legends appearances for game(s) in London, networking opportunities, Jaguars Legends signings, community and game-day appearances (gameday signings, suite visits, partnership appearances, Legends hosted in suites and cabanas).
- Coordinate career support services that connect Legends with resources, including professional development programs, training opportunities, and networking events.
- Serve as the team liaison for NFL Legends Community/League office - meetings, team calls, and any program communication and implementation.
- Stay current on all league and players association policies and programs related to former players.
- Cooperate with Partnerships and Sales teams on requests for Legend appearances.
- Develop goals, metrics, and processes for measuring performance for Legends Department programs; maintain an accurate and efficient system of program reporting to reflect investment impact.
- Coordinate the development and implementation of Legends outreach programs.
- Establish and build relationships with a wide range of Legends: maintain regular communication with Legends via direct contact, phone calls, email campaigns, events, and social media; ensure the existence and comprehensive and accurate alumni databases, as well as personal information provided by Legends is handled professionally and confidentially.
- Assist in program assessment and goal setting for the upcoming year.
- Develop and maintain Legends sponsorship presentation deck for potential partners.
- Assist in producing annual comprehensive summary of all Legends outreach.
- Manage the Jaguars Legends website and Facebook account and provide content to include recaps of Legend appearances, announcements of upcoming events, and relevant features on Jaguars Legends.
- Coordinate and maintain yearly budget for all Legends programs.
- Accountable for ensuring Legends-based programs, which include sponsor elements, reach fulfillment.
- Support all current and new community outreach efforts.
- Assist with Community Impact and Football Development responsibilities and assignments.
- Other tasks as assigned.
